Transaction 0577dfea44fb6a8525f585282cf7fe767c165bb99eca5fdb05df62f668e0ff66

42 Input
2 Outputs
  • 0577dfea44fb6a8525f585282cf7fe767c165bb99eca5fdb05df62f668e0ff66:0
  • value  99729
    address  3LcEwh1XdMd9zomyboxa4kFCiMeHC59o6y
  • 0577dfea44fb6a8525f585282cf7fe767c165bb99eca5fdb05df62f668e0ff66:1
  • value  99729926
    address  1VtRsUxttx7ZYYaPuNaVGLQpF9w7TGVCn